A pedestrian was struck and killed by a BMW in Georgetown Thursday evening, according to officials.
A 2018 BMW 430xi Coupe struck the man at about 5:41 p.m. near 50 West Main St., the Essex County District Attorney’s Office said.
The pedestrian was rushed to Merrimack Health Haverhill Hospital, where he was pronounced dead, according to the DA’s office. Authorities have not publicly identified him, pending notification of his next of kin.
The BMW driver remained at the scene.
Massachusetts State Police and the Georgetown Police Department are investigating the collision.
